Merge branch 'awoloszyn-fix-block-decoration' into 'vulkan-cts-1.0'
authorPyry Haulos <phaulos@google.com>
Tue, 26 Jan 2016 17:14:37 +0000 (12:14 -0500)
committerPyry Haulos <phaulos@google.com>
Tue, 26 Jan 2016 17:14:37 +0000 (12:14 -0500)
commitc504c40aa7c19ef2780a948e6da3e380f0b78b3e
treeb5e92723f4eed70762443fe6141e3ec10d3efd3d
parentfb93fd6ae266af78e76cd50fa6546d22314b2a6b
parentcb8de68ba40a8cc2330e63d592955406ee22b38f
Merge branch 'awoloszyn-fix-block-decoration' into 'vulkan-cts-1.0'

Fixes block order and decoration group tests.

Fixes #257

Round the input values to integer numbers so that the computations
never have to round.

The tests in question only perform addition and subtraction, and all
well within the representable range of a float. (-1500 -> 1500)

See merge request !397
external/vulkancts/modules/vulkan/spirv_assembly/vktSpvAsmInstructionTests.cpp